Transaction c2e758b3c4a35af69f51dc558dfd103e923e339e526c931084aafdb5a3e1b5f2

2 Input
2 Outputs
  • c2e758b3c4a35af69f51dc558dfd103e923e339e526c931084aafdb5a3e1b5f2:0
  • value  10621883
    address  1EHbce74cQb2kriYx2njuXub4ncWb6Nn4t
  • c2e758b3c4a35af69f51dc558dfd103e923e339e526c931084aafdb5a3e1b5f2:1
  • value  23162500
    address  1NNnEjFDXi61dXqiomt8ChHpbMhvyFhMkh